Output 630180817d87cb3d1657d7e1012187796131f318230948eb5f5110e29346fc57:0

value
53682268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e59c3a8e4a6add7b8faed1455ec729733e206001 OP_EQUAL
address
3Nd5pSDja7NKPYvqcQxJd5fjR2THcoG6DM
transaction
630180817d87cb3d1657d7e1012187796131f318230948eb5f5110e29346fc57
confirmations
109160
spent
true